Tape several takes with a director leading your ability. Guarantee you have enough coverage and several great takes of each line. When it pertains to manufacturing, toenailing your shots is crucial. You do not intend to be stuck having to reshoot because you really did not obtain enough good takes of each line.


As a director, web Chris suches as to obtain at least 2 really great takes of every line prior to entering into the edit. When we dealt with the Welcome to Wistia task, we alloted three days for manufacturing, however just two for really shooting around the office. Why 2 days, you ask? Well, our office had not been precisely camera-ready.


You just could not vomit a camera and start capturing. Remember, we wanted our videos to be shiny, so we needed to be very deliberate with our collection design, props, illumination, and every little thing that comprised the shot. Giving on your own adequate time during manufacturing is essential to guaranteeing your shots are place on.

At Wistia, we usually will not pull a framework from the video clip and tack it on as the video thumbnail. We'll ask our style group to create a personalized thumbnail due to the fact that doing so can aid increase video clip play price.
